PHOTOGRAPHIC COMPETITION FOR FRESHMEN STARTS AT 7

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

A competition for the Photographic Department of the CRIMSON will start at 7 o'clock this evening for all Freshmen who are interested with a meeting in the Crimson Building, at which the work of the competition will be outlined. Particular attention is called to the fact that no previous experience in any branch of photography is necessary. The competition will last 11 weeks.
